Output 8cb84d666480ac303a0cd1678208a6117120dfdeb6d70cfcd4db5626a4e3139e:1

value
2577901
script pubkey
OP_0 OP_PUSHBYTES_32 1057255adc3aaa3048661b95c43baeaad576c78579a90a1ff218f7765b1e1430
address
bc1qzptj2kku824rqjrxrw2ugwaw4t2hd3u90x5s58ljrrmhvkc7zscqeyrdfw
transaction
8cb84d666480ac303a0cd1678208a6117120dfdeb6d70cfcd4db5626a4e3139e
spent
true